Boost the radiance of her complexion, blur some fine lines, redraw the contours of her lips ... discover all our makeup tips to rejuvenate a few years.
1.Illuminate your complexion
Often dry and dull, mature skin needs a little boost to regain radiance. The good reflex: apply a pearly base, before the foundation or alone on the face, then deposit a more intense illuminator on the bulges of the face. What redraw the volumes and give the illusion of a younger skin.
2.Curling her eyelashes

3.Flouting the lines
The filling and smoothing bases (also called "blur") are ideal for those who want to reduce the fine lines of crow's feet, contours of the mouth or forehead. They also provide better hold foundation, matte lipstick or eyeshadow. To prevent your lipstick from running into fine lines during the day, consider also applying a transparent outline pencil.
4.Redraw the lips
If your lips tend to refine with age and their contours to be less clear, know that there are very simple makeup tricks to redraw them. Start by applying a pencil (the same color as your matte lipstick ) on the contours and the center and correct any asymmetries. Then apply your red, taking care to choose a creamy texture very bright (avoid the dull that shrinks the lips).
5.Sculpting your eyelids
The drooping eyelids have the peculiarity of having an almost invisible fold. To recreate it, apply a dark shadow in the desired area with small back-and-forth movements. Then apply a bright and clear shade in the eye and under the eyebrow to restore volume and size to your eyes.
6. Camouflage her dark circles
Nothing worse than a marked look and surrounded to look much older ... For a youthful look, take the time to camouflage your dark circles with a corrector well-covering non-drying (it might mark your fine lines). The trick: choose 1 tone or 1 halftone lighter than your complexion to brighten your eyes.
